Transaction 99fecfee815ca07c7352839f2e6979226be4c06039c075b73ac4f7a0faf77f69

2 Input
2 Outputs
  • 99fecfee815ca07c7352839f2e6979226be4c06039c075b73ac4f7a0faf77f69:0
  • value  6422766
    address  1LDiiFWixKkTZQsVsZ8YLm8UQ6k22rZVo
  • 99fecfee815ca07c7352839f2e6979226be4c06039c075b73ac4f7a0faf77f69:1
  • value  26000000
    address  18nmuKW6NA6BnM6kTnD1secuYmcpUsWm2M